Odhner, N. [H.]
Two letters to R. P. Dollfus.
Stockholm, 1948-1950. Two printed leaves (29.2 x 22.8 cm [1948] and 29.7 x 21 cm [1950]). The first letter typed, with hand-written signature and additional handwriting; the second entirely handwritten, signed and dated.
Two letters, on the stationery of the Naturhistoriska Riksmuseum in Stockholm, from the Swedish malacologist Nils Hjalmar Odhner (1884-1973) to the French marine biologist, ichthyologist, parasitologist, and director of the Service des Pêches Coloniales, Robert Philippe F. Dollfus (1887-1976). Dollfus was a son of the malacologist Gustave Frédérique Dollfus (co-author of the famous Les mollusques marins du Rousillon), and was interested in Mollusca himself. Paul Henri Fischer wrote his necrologie in the Journal de Conchyliologie 114(3-4), p. 131. In these letters, Odhner discusses several topics, including the whereabouts of captain C. O. Johnson - who collected cetaceans - a forthcoming paper on the landsnails of the Galapagos Archipelago, etc. First (1948) letter frayed at right margin, otherwise very good.
